British-Nigerian artist Olaolu Slawn is set to make history with his inaugural collaboration with Nike, introducing two unique renditions of the iconic Air Max 90. This partnership not only showcases Slawn’s distinctive artistic flair but also marks a significant milestone as he becomes the first Nigerian-born artist to design a Nike sneaker. The collection is scheduled for release on April 4th, 2025, initially through German retailer BSTN, with a wider release on Nike.com expected to follow. Each pair will retail for $150 USD.
The collaboration features two distinct colorways: a bold black version and a minimalist sail edition. The black pair is adorned with white speckled paint splatters, reminiscent of Slawn’s dynamic studio environment and cosmic inspirations. A textured white Swoosh provides a striking contrast, while metallic silver eyelets and custom heel branding add a touch of sophistication. In contrast, the sail colorway offers a clean, monochromatic aesthetic with gold eyelets enhancing its elegant design. Both versions showcase a reimagined mudguard that wraps around the shoe, deviating from the traditional design and highlighting Slawn’s innovative approach. The quarter panels feature deep texturing, and the heel tabs display stylized eyes, a signature element in Slawn’s artwork.

Slawn first teased this groundbreaking collaboration on February 2, 2025, through his social media channels. In his announcement, he expressed pride in being the “first born and bred Nigerian with a Nike shoe collaboration,” emphasizing the collectible nature of the release. This early reveal generated significant buzz within both the art and sneaker communities, eager to see how Slawn’s vibrant and street-inspired aesthetic would translate onto the classic Air Max 90 silhouette.
